Quick Healthy Sautéed Mushrooms with Spinach

  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 cups fresh spinach
  • 2 cups button mushrooms, s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Clean mushrooms with a damp cloth and slice evenly.
  2. Rinse spinach and pat dry.
  3.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at until shimmering.
  4. Add sliced mushrooms to the skillet and sauté for 5-7 minutes until golden brown.
  5. Stir in minced garlic and cook for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
  6. Add spinach to the skillet and toss until wilted.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  7. Serve warm as a side dish or light meal.
